Xsolla is a licensed merchant of record (MoR) payment processor that serves the video game business. The service comes with an array of functions that provides game makers with the tools required to sell their games online, and to accept international online payments with no needing to deal with localization, sales tax VAT, fraud prevention by themselves. However, Xsolla isn't a great choice for every company that might have specific demands on features, geographic services, or support which Xsolla isn't able to meet.

3 Additional Xsolla Competitors

Stripe

Screenshot of Xsolla competitor Stripe's home page, a diagonal colorful gradient with screenshots of their apps.

Stripe is an incredibly well-known payment processor for DIY that enables companies to accept credit or debit cards as well as mobile payment. But, it's crucial to be aware that Stripe isn't an MoR. This lets Stripe to give you the lowest price compared to the managed services a merchant of record could provide, since many of the tax compliance vendors in addition to fraud and tax management times which are required to be compliant internationally are not included. So, you'll need to be responsible for the costs of these companies as well as the time.

In many companies, additional costs from providers, such as time spent on accountants, tax experts, and the development team's time required to create complex integrations between various systems that use Stripe are the total cost of ownership higher than a traditional merchant that has a record, such as Xsolla or . However, the most common reason to go using an official merchant rather than DIY payment providers like Stripe and Xsolla is to save time. If the engineers of your gaming development firm is distracted with the back-office finance system and the compliance needed with a DIY integration it is more focussed in making your gaming experience better.

Use Stripe If you're trying to cut some points off the cost of transactions vs. an MoR -- and if you feel you've got the capacity and time expertise, understanding, and efficiency within your engineering and finance teams to handle and integrate international payment transactions, in addition to tax compliance for your company.

Coda payments

Screenshot of Xsolla competitor Coda Payments' home page, mostly purple with a diagonal yellow stripe and overlaid with images of cell phones showing their app.

Coda Payments is a Singapore-headquartered competitor to Xsolla that enables video game companies to accept payments globally. Based on the package of payment the customer chooses to buy, Coda Payments may or be able to act as an MoR.

The Codapay product is a part of The company Codapay product is in direct opposition to Xsolla and provides embedded payments to publishers' game shop or the use of Coda's webshop.
